Membership Growth and Accessibility
Since its launch, this fitness facility has experienced notable membership growth. Its focus on affordable, non-intimidating spaces has drawn a diverse membership base—from fitness newcomers to long-time enthusiasts. The gym’s commitment to accessibility has been a key driver of this success.
Flexible membership options, including day passes and monthly subscriptions, make it easy for people to fit fitness into their budgets and daily routines. This approach has not only boosted membership numbers but also encouraged more individuals to prioritize their health and well-being.
Fostering a Fitness Culture
This facility plays a crucial role in nurturing a community fitness culture. Its inclusive atmosphere and regular community events help break down barriers to physical activity. For example, it offers a variety of classes—from yoga and cycling to kickboxing—that suit different fitness levels and interests.
Additionally, it actively engages with local schools and organizations to promote health education. Partnerships with schools include fitness challenges, while workshops on nutrition and exercise help instill lifelong healthy habits in young people, passing on the benefits of physical activity to future generations.
